Abstract

Newton trajectories are used for the Frenkel-Kontorova model of a finite chain with free-end bound- ary conditions. We optimise stationary structures, as well as barrier breakdown points for a critical tilting force were depinning of the chain happens. These special points can be obtained straight for- wardly by the tool of Newton trajectories. We explain the theory and add examples for a finite-length chain of a fixed number of 2, 3, 4, 5 and 23 particles.
